Leviticus 23:36-38
1599 Geneva Bible
36 Seven days ye shall offer (A)sacrifice made by fire unto the Lord, and in the eighth day shall be an holy convocation unto you, and ye shall offer sacrifices made by fire unto the Lord: it is the [a]solemn assembly, ye shall do no servile work therein.
37 These are the feasts of the Lord (which ye shall call holy convocations) to offer sacrifice made by fire unto the Lord, as burnt offering, and meat offering, [b]sacrifice, and drink offerings, every one upon his day,
38 Beside the Sabbaths of the Lord, and beside your gifts, and beside all your vows, and beside all your free offerings, which ye shall give unto the Lord.

- Leviticus 23:36 Or, a day wherein the people are stayed from all work.
- Leviticus 23:37 Or, peace offering.
